摘要: BS20-T is a thermo-sensitive genic male sterile (TGMS) wheat line (Triticum aestivum L.) used in hybrid wheat breeding in northern China. BS20-T was crossed with common wheat variety ZN7. F-1 plants were highly fertile. The segregation ratio of male fertile and male sterile individuals in F-2 and BC1F1 plants were close to 3:1 and 1:1, respectively. Other crosses of BS20-T also segregated for a single gene. Bulked sergeant analysis with SSR markers indicated the sterility gene was located on chromosome 2BL. It was named tmsBS20T. Screening of 162 extremely sterile and 30 extremely fertile F-2 plants with linked markers indicated flanking by gwm403 and gwm374 with genetic distances of 2.2 and 4.5 cM, respectively. tmsBS20T was transferred into several common wheat varieties by using traditional hybridization combined with marker assisted selection with these two markers. Further identification of derived TGMS lines is ongoing.
